Tolbutamide and alcohol
Tolbutamide clearance from the bloodstream is increased if a patient drinks heavily. Levels of tolbutamide are approximately halved in those drinking 30 units per day.
Reference:
- Drugs and Therapeutics Bulletin (1996), Drugs and alcohol: harmful cocktails?, 34 (5), 36-8.
- Iber FL (1977), Drug metabolism in heavy consumers of ethyl alcohol, Clin Pharmacol Ther, 22, 735-42.
